Understanding the Risks and Industry Standards
Online gambling platforms operate within a complex web of regulations, technological safeguards, and payment systems. Reputable platforms abide by licensing authorities such as the UK Gambling Commission, Gibraltar Gambling Division, or Malta Gaming Authority, which enforce stringent standards on payout processes and fair play.
However, many emerging sites lack transparency or proper regulation, prompting users to seek credible information before engaging or depositing funds. A key concern remains whether these platforms genuinely honour their payout commitments when players win.

Guidelines for Consumers: How to Assess Payout Credibility
- Verify Licensing: Check if the platform is licensed by reputable authorities.
- Research User Feedback: Seek verified reviews from independent sources.
- Review Payment Policies: Understand withdrawal procedures, limits, and fees.
- Test Small Withdrawals: Before committing large sums, attempt smaller payouts to test efficiency.
- Observe Transparency: Platforms that detail payout timelines and have robust customer support are preferable.
